Transaction 589885a2290278857963899b147ba906edb964294661e8c93613148531fb3ba4
1 Input
1 Output
-
589885a2290278857963899b147ba906edb964294661e8c93613148531fb3ba4:0
- value
- 197970
- script pubkey
- OP_0 OP_PUSHBYTES_32 c7b298ba942f1e2a8d13168a590f02edceb11322b315e31de21c600d5b1c8a7e
- address
- bc1qc7ef3w559u0z4rgnz699jrczah8tzyezkv27x80zr3sq6kcu3flq6p4744